⚽ Hansa Rostock (Germany)
Hansa Rostock is a football club based in Rostock, Germany.
The club holds a special place in the hearts of the local community, providing a source of pride and unity for fans eagerly supporting their team. The vibrant football culture here is intertwined with the city’s history, making every match day a festival of camaraderie and local spirit.
🏟️ Foundation & General Information
- Founded: 1965
- Full name: F.C. Hansa Rostock e.V.
- Home stadium: Ostseestadion
- Official website: www.hansa-rostock.de
